I promote a modified version of webi report ‘x’ from DEV to QA using LCM. So now I’ve ‘x1’ in QA.
2 I “rollback” this promotion job in LCM. Which means I’ve get back ‘x’ in QA system.
So does this mean that LCM kept a “backup” copy of ‘x’ in QA (CMS+filestore file backup) before overwriting with the promoted ‘x1’ from DEV?
If yes, does it clear the ‘x’ anytime from QA? (maybe after second iteration of ‘x2’?)
What that means is that if you had five iterations and rolled back, the fifth would be removed, from job history, then you would have the option to roll back to version 4, if you wish.
Rollback happens one iteration at a time, make sense?
You should think of these as snapshots of the promotions / system.
